Two energetic coordination polymers, Pb 2 (AOT) 2 ·7(H 2 O) (1) (AOT: 5,5′-azo-bis(1-oxidotetrazonate)) and Pb 2 (AOT)O·3(H 2 O) (2), were prepared at different temperatures and pressures. X-ray data indicate that compound 1 is a 1D structure, while compound 2 is a compact 3D structure. Unlike previous methods on structural modulation, changes of organic ligands or metal nodes are not needed in this work. Experimental analysis and energetic evaluations show that 2 exhibits better mechanical sensitivity, thermal stability, and detonation performance than 1.
